By: Abba Onyekachukwu, Abuja.
The Federal Ministry of Industry, Trade and Investment (FMITI) has received an appeal from JonahCapital Nigeria Limited and Houses for Africa Nigeria Limited regarding issues of corporate records alteration and administrative actions, according to a press release from Obilor -Duru Augustina Okechi,
Head Press and Public Relations on Monday.
The Ministry notes the matters are subject to ongoing judicial proceedings in the High Court of the Federal Capital Territory and Federal High Court, Abuja, with subsisting interlocutory orders directing parties to maintain the status quo.
The Ministry affirms its commitment to constitutionalism, rule of law, and respect for the doctrine of sub judice, ensuring no interference with the courts’ authority.
The appeal is being reviewed within the Ministry’s administrative oversight, without prejudice to judicial processes and court orders.
The Ministry reassures stakeholders of its commitment to investor confidence, due process, and transparent regulatory frameworks, urging respect for court orders and the legal process.
